Understanding Rowlett Car Title Loans: A Basic Guide
Rowlett car title loans are a type of secured lending that allows individuals to use their vehicle’s equity as collateral. This alternative financing option is popular among those who need quick access to cash but may not qualify for traditional bank loans. Here, a lender provides a loan based on the current value of your vehicle, after taking into account its make, model, year, and overall condition. The process involves evaluating your vehicle’s vehicle valuation to determine the maximum loan amount you could receive.
Once approved, you’ll be required to hand over the title of your vehicle to the lender until the loan is repaid. Repayment typically occurs in regular installments, and upon settling the loan balance, you’ll get your vehicle title back. An important aspect to note is that if you fail to make payments as agreed, the lender reserves the right to repossess your vehicle. Additionally, some lenders may offer options for loan extension if unexpected financial hardships arise during the repayment period.
How Lenders Evaluate Your Vehicle for Loan Approval
When applying for a Rowlett car title loan, lenders carefully assess your vehicle’s value and condition to determine approval amounts. They use several factors to evaluate your ride, including its make, model, year, overall condition, and current market value. Unlike traditional loans where credit scores play a significant role, these loans primarily rely on the equity in your vehicle.
The lender will inspect the car, truck, or RV to ensure it’s in drivable condition and accurately assess its worth. They might compare it to similar vehicles sold recently, taking into account features, mileage, and any necessary repairs.
